Recipe Here: Gochujang Chicken Skillet


  • Author: Emma Skillet
  • Total Time: 25 Minutes
  • Yield: 4 Servings 1x

Description

Gochujang Chicken Skillet is a sticky one-pan 25-minute dinner with tender chicken, Korean chili paste, garlic, and a glossy sweet-spicy sauce. Easy weeknight me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 1/2 pounds boneless skinless chicken thighs
    or chicken breasts, cut into bite-size pieces

  • 1 tablespoon neutral oil

  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per

  • 3 garlic cloves, minced

  • 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, grated
    optional

  • 1/2 cup diced onion
    optional

  • 1 cup shredded cabbage
    optional, cooks fast

Sticky Gochujang Sauce

  • 3 tablespoons gochujang
  • 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ce

  • 2 tablespoons honey
    or brown sugar

  • 1 tablespoon rice vinegar

  • 1 tablespoon water

  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il

  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ch + 1 tablespoon water
    optional slurry for extra stickiness

Toppings (optional)

 

  • 2 green onions, sliced
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ds

  • Lime wedges


Instructions

  1. Pat chicken dry and season with salt and pepper.

  2.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.

  3. Add chicken and cook 6 to 8 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ned and cooked through to 165°F.

  4. Add onion (optional) and cook 2 minutes.

  5. Add garlic and ginger and cook 30 seconds.

  6. Whisk gochujang, soy sauce, honey, vinegar, water, and sesame oil in a bowl.

  7. Pour sauce into skillet and stir 1 minute.

  8. Optional: stir in slurry and simmer 30 to 60 seconds until glossy and sticky.

  9. Add cabbage (optional) and toss 1 minute until slightly softened.

  10. Top with green onions and sesame seeds and serve.

Notes

  • Start with 2 tablespoons gochujang for mild-medium heat.
  • Use the slurry only if you want extra sticky glaze.
  • Add a splash of water when reheating leftovers.
  • Great for bowls: serve over rice with cucumber and lime.
